Dacryocystorhinostomy (DCR) is the definitive management for nasolacrimal duct obstruction. External and endonasal are the two approaches, external DCR (Ex-DCR) being the gold standard method. Due to better cosmetic outcome with relatively preserved lacrimal pump function, endonasal DCR (En-DCR) has gained popularity over external approach. Various studies have shown better outcomes in terms of functional benefits with Ex-DCR approach. Also, simultaneous canalicular obstructions can be treated with Ex-DCR which is a major drawback in En-DCR.
